찾다

 >  Q&A  >  본문

macos - OS X升级10.11后gem无法使用

执行了一下,gem install ***
提示:

ERROR: While executing gem ... (Gem::FilePermissionError)
You don't have write permissions for the /Library/Ruby/Gems/2.0.0 directory.

于是用,sudo gem install ***
提示:

ERROR: While executing gem ... (Errno::EPERM)
Operation not permitted - /usr/bin/***

之前用10.10时没有这个情况,大家有遇到过这个问题吗?

PHP中文网PHP中文网2760일 전932

모든 응답(3)나는 대답할 것이다

  • PHP中文网

    PHP中文网2017-04-24 16:01:16

    csrutil disable 실행 후 다시 시작이 가능해야 합니다. 10.11로 업그레이드한 후 많은 앱에서 이러한 문제가 발생했습니다.

    그런데 문제가 있어서 brew install ruby를 사용하여 다른 것을 구한 뒤 정상적으로 실행되었습니다.

    회신하다
    0
  • PHPz

    PHPz2017-04-24 16:01:16

    이것은 SIP(시스템 무결성 보호) 때문입니다.

    복구 모드로 가서 터미널을 열고 csrutil disable을 입력한 후 실행 후 다시 시작해야 합니다.

    회신하다
    0
  • phpcn_u1582

    phpcn_u15822017-04-24 16:01:16

    뿌리없는

    회신하다
    0
  • 취소회신하다